And the American website (Avera), which specializes in health affairs, provided a series of tips for those wishing to recreate in the dark the summerSuch as:

stay hydrated: Drinking water is necessary throughout the year, but it is more necessary in the summer, when the high temperature makes it difficult to keep the body hydrated, so it is appropriate for a person to keep a water bottle with him.

Do not forget regarding the signs of heat-related diseases: Staying for a long time under the scorching sun can expose you to many health problems such as heat stroke, and to avoid this, it is recommended to wear dark-colored clothes, and take a rest in the shade area, where the body can also moisturize.

This helps prevent heat-related illnesses such as dehydration, whose symptoms include headaches, nausea and vomiting.

Sun protection: Putting the cream on the skin plays an important role in protecting the skin from the heat of the sun, and it is preferable for a person to practice this on a daily basis, especially if he frequently goes out and walks.

wear glasses: Sunglasses are a perfect accessory all year round, but when the sun’s rays are strong, it is appropriate to wear these sunglasses, as they block the harmful UV rays for the eyes.

healthy food: Eating healthy food, especially water-rich vegetables and fruits like watermelon, helps the body stay fresh and healthy.

Protective measures in swimming and hiking: Forest fires are one of the most prominent summer accidents, so attention should be paid to the issue of setting fires and fireworks, these things may lead to a disaster, so it is important to take the weather condition into account, for example, hot and dry weather contributes to setting fires, as for swimming, it is necessary for children to be Under an adult, they are provided with protective equipment such as life jackets.
